Dozzle is a lightweight, self-hosted web application for real-time viewing and monitoring of container logs, focused on speed and simplicity rather than building a full log storage pipeline. Instead of indexing or storing logs, it connects to your container runtime and streams live output so you can diagnose issues as they happen. The interface includes practical quality-of-life features like fuzzy searching for containers, regex log search, split-screen viewing for multiple logs, and live stats such as CPU and memory usage. It supports more advanced analysis through an in-browser SQL query engine for querying logs, which helps when you need structured filtering without exporting data elsewhere. Dozzle also supports multi-user authentication and can integrate with proxy-forward authorization setups for deployments behind gateways. For larger environments, it can monitor multiple hosts via an agent mode and supports orchestrators like Docker Swarm and Kubernetes.
